INTERVENTION TYPE PERIODICITY
cleaning of external surfaces 6 months
checking of screw tightening 6 months
checking of release mechanism operation 6 months
electric brake cleaning 6 months
TROUBLE-SHOOTING
Description
Possible solutions
When the opening or closing command is activated the
gate leaf fails to move and the operator’s electric mo-
tor fails to start.
Theoperatorisnotreceivingcorrectpowersupply.Checkallconnections,fuses,andthe
powersupplycableconditionsandreplaceorrepairifnecessary.Ifthegatedoesnotclose
checkthecorrectfunctioningofphotocells.
When the opening command is activated, the motor
starts but the gate leafs fail to move.
Checkthattheunlockingsystemisclosed(seePic.8).
Checktheelectronicforceadjustmentdeviceandthemechanicalclutch.
Makesurethatthemotordoesnotpushintheoppositedirection,thelimitswitchelectri-
calconnectionsmightbereversed.
The gate moves by fits and starts, it is noisy, it stops at
half run or it does not start.
Makesurethatnothinghindersthegatewheelsmovementandtheslideinwhichtheyroll.
Therealwaysmustbebacklashbetweenrackandpinion;makesuretherackisaccura-
telypositioned.
Thepowerofthegearmotormaybeinsufficientforthecharacteristicsofthegate’swing;
checkthechoiceofmodelwheneverrequiredh.
Iftheoperatorattachmenttothegatebendsorisbadlyfastened,repairand/orbuttress
it.
